Layered Pepperoni Mushroom Pizza Stacks
Ingredients:
2 flatbreads, cut into rounds
1/2 cup pesto sauce
1 1/2 cups mozzarella cheese
8 slices pepperoni
1/2 cup grilled mushrooms
Fresh basil for garnish
Instructions:
Preheat oven to 375°F.
Spread pesto on each flatbread round.
Layer cheese, pepperoni, and grilled mushrooms.
Stack the rounds and bake for 12-15 minutes. Garnish with basil.
Serve with a fresh green salad.

Step-by-Step Guide
1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ures it’s at the perfect temperature for even cooking and a crispy base.
2. Using a round cookie cutter or a small bowl as a guide, cut your flatbreads into equal-sized rounds. Aim for 4-6 rounds per flatbread.
3. Place the rounds on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Spread a generous, even layer of pesto sauce on each round, leaving a small border around the edge.
4. Sprinkle a base layer of shredded mozzarella cheese on top of the pesto on each round.
5. Add your toppings: place 1-2 slices of pepperoni and a few pieces of grilled mushroom on each round.
6. Carefully stack the prepared rounds on top of each other, creating a tower. For stability, ensure the toppings are evenly distributed.
7. Bake the stack in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until the cheese is fully melted and bubbly and the edges of the flatbread are golden brown.
8. Remove from the oven, let it cool for 2-3 minutes, then garnish with fresh basil leaves.
Serving Suggestions
These pizza stacks are a fantastic centerpiece for casual dining. Serve them whole for a dramatic presentation, letting everyone pull apart their own layers, or slice them into quarters for easy sharing. Pair them with a simple fresh green salad with a light vinaigrette to cut through the richness. For a heartier meal, add a side of garlic bread knots or a bowl of tomato soup for dipping.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make these stacks ahead of time? You can prepare the individual layered rounds up to a few hours in advance. Keep them covered in the fridge, but only stack and bake them right before serving to prevent sogginess.
What can I use instead of flatbread? Pre-made pizza dough, naan, or even large flour tortillas work well. Adjust baking time slightly based on thickness.
How do I prevent the stack from falling over? Ensure your topping layers are even and not too bulky. Using a skewer inserted down the center after baking can help stabilize a tall stack for serving.
Can I use a different sauce? Absolutely. Marinara, Alfredo, or a spicy arrabbiata sauce are excellent alternatives to pesto.
How do I store and reheat leftovers? Store cooled le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Reheat in a toaster oven or conventional oven at 350°F until warm to maintain crispiness.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Avoid overloading the layers with too many wet ingredients, which can make the flatbread soggy. Ensure your grilled mushrooms are well-drained and patted dry. Do not skip preheating the oven, as a cold start will steam the bread instead of crisping it. Finally, let the stack rest for a few minutes after baking; this allows the cheese to set slightly, making it easier to slice.
